Andrew Kryder is currently the Director at JW House.
Previously, he worked as the General Counsel & Vice President-Tax at Quantum Corp.
from 1990 to 2000, Tax Partner at Ernst & Young LLP (Missouri) from 1977 to 1990, Secretary & General Counsel at Network Appliance, Inc. from 2006 to 2008, and Secretary, General Counsel & SVP-Tax at NetApp, Inc. from 2000 to 2010.
Mr. Kryder holds an MBA from Santa Clara University, as well as an undergraduate and graduate degree from the same institution.
